'Paris'
Description: Parlez-vous Francais? Suggested by a girl of the same name, I remember my infatuation with her and with the composition as it came out on a baby grand piano somewhere in Southern California. Drawing upon my trip to France in August, 1998, and overwhelmed by the countryside in the north which bore the brunt of Nazi forces, I have included portions of President Charles de Gaulle's address to the people of France, as well as a generic lovers' conversation, to suggest perhaps that all is fair in love and war, and that both should be declared... Story Behind the Music: Written in 1975, and while I had an analog recording made a few years later, it wasn't until late in the 80's that I finally recorded the individual tracks in a digital format. But upon the completion of the basic tracks, no further work had been done until Michael French and I began to lay out its production in Studio B early in June, 2001. After laying out the basic instruments, we moved to Studio A and proceeded to create new tracks including many guitar parts, both electric and acoustic which had never been recorded. I had always envisioned a French ambience to the production to include French language dialogue as a way of creating that certain, yet elusive 'je ne sais quoi' of France. |
Production began 06/15/01 and mastered 09/16/01
